The human dopamine transporter (hDAT) contains a high-affinity, extracellular, and allosteric Zn 2+ (zinc ion) binding site which, upon zinc binding, inhibits dopamine reuptake, inhibits amphetamine-induced hDAT internalization, and amplifies amphetamine-induced dopamine efflux
